VEEV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2025 in Review

1,118 of the 7,620 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Veeva Systems (VEEV) for Q3 2025, worth a combined $41.8B — up 3.8% from $40.3B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 129 funds opened new VEEV positions and 105 closed out — a net gain of 24 holders — while 439 added to existing stakes and 371 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Alphinity Investment Management, opening a new position worth an estimated $399M. The largest seller was VanEck Associates, cutting an estimated $191M.
